Alisher Kadyrov, the leader of the "Milliy Tiklanish" party, made a statement regarding the current system of language selection for education in Uzbekistan's schools. According to him, the existing practice, where parents decide on the language of instruction, infringes on the rights of the children themselves. Kadyrov emphasized that a child should have the opportunity to learn in their native language, as it is a fundamental factor for successful knowledge acquisition and holistic development.

He argued that learning in a non-native language often creates additional challenges for students, which can negatively impact their academic performance and limit future opportunities. In Kadyrov's view, a mistake in choosing the language of instruction can lead to difficulties in understanding the educational material, hinder the learning process, and consequently reduce the quality of education.

Alisher Kadyrov reached out to the children's ombudsman with several proposals to reconsider the current approach to language selection for education. He urged that the child's opinion be taken into account when making decisions about the language of instruction, granting them a voice in this important matter.

The party leader expressed confidence that such changes would help create more favorable conditions for children's development and ensure equal opportunities for receiving quality education.
